Home site EPFL Windows.epfl.ch
Découverte des objets machines dans l'explorateur réseaux

Les lignes suivantes résument les points clés concernant le browsing :

  • Le browsing est basé essentiellement sur le broadcast
  • Chaque sous réseau aura un maître explorateur local ainsi que des explorateur de backup : ceci est vrai pour chaque domaine du sous réseau.
  • Le maître explorateur local a comme rôle de construire une liste du sous réseau à partir des différents annonces émises par les machines à des intervalles réguliers
  • Chaque maître explorateur local communique sa liste au maître explorateur du domaine de son domaine : il devrait donc être capable de résoudre l’enregistrement Netbios nomdudomaine <1B>

Afin de trouver à quel niveau se pose le problème, voici le plan d’action que je vous propose :

D’abord localiser les machines qui n’apparaissent pas dans le voisinage réseau.

Sur une de ces machines vérifier les points suivants :

1.-     nbtstat -an
          il devra ressembler au résultat suivant : (ça permet de vérifier si la machines s’est bien enregistrée sur le réseau)

Local Area Connection:
Node IpAddress: [128.178.1.69] Scope Id: []

             NetBIOS Local Name Table

    Name               Type         Status
    ---------------------------------------------
    Machine     <00>  UNIQUE      Registered
    Machine     <20>  UNIQUE      Registered
    Machine     <03>  UNIQUE      Registered

 

2.-     net config server
    
  voir si la machine n’est pas cachée ou si il y a un long commentaire qui fait plus que 48 caractères.

3.-     Vérifier que le service RPC est bien démarré

4.-     A l’aide de la liste des commandes en dessous effectuez ce qui suit sur le sous réseau auquel appartiennent ces machines :

Afficher la statut du service browser et trouvez le maître d’exploration local, vérifiez qu’il n’a pas deux cartes réseau et qu’il ne rencontre pas des problèmes réseau (vérifiez s’il est bien configuré à utiliser Wins et que le ping du pdc emulator passe bien) Affichez la liste des machines gérées par ce maître d’exploration local, et assurez vous qu’elle contienne au moins toutes les machines de ce sous réseau.

 

Provoquer l’annonce des machines qui n’existent pas sur la liste.

Assurez vous aussi que ce maître explorateur local arrive bien à retrouver le maître explorateur du domaine (commande 3, ci-dessous)

Listes des commandes :

1.- Afficher le statut du service browser sur votre domaine :

C:\Program Files\Resource Kit>browstat status

Cette commande va permettre aussi d’afficher le transport utilisé pour l’échange de listes, afin de pouvoir utilisé les autres switch de la commande browstat il faudrait copier la ligne qui correspond à ce transport.

Exemple:
dans cet exemple la ligne à copier est \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728}

C:\Program Files\Resource Kit>browstat status

Status for domain PARIS on transport \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2- AA67-E5335D2BD728}    Browsing is active on domain.
    Master browser name is: xxxxx
        Master browser is running build 1381
    1 backup servers retrieved from master xxxxx
        \\xxxxxxxx
    There are 402 servers in domain PARIS on transport \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728}
    There are 316 domains in domain PARIS on transport \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728}

2.- Afficher le nom du maître d’exploration local « local master browser » :
      Browstat + GETMASTER + transport + nom netbios du domaine

C:\Program Files\Resource Kit>browstat GETMASTER \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728} paris

3.- Afficher le nom du maître d’exploration du domaine « domaine master browser » :
      Browstat + GETPDC + transport + nom netbios du domaine

C:\Program Files\Resource Kit>browstat GETPDC \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728} paris

4.- Afficher la liste des machines gérées par le maître d’exploration local :
      Browstat + VIEW+ transport + nom netbios du domaine + le maître d’exploration local   (le résultat du point 2)

C:\Program Files\Resource Kit>browstat view \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728} paris \\toto

5.- Afficher la liste des machines gérées par le maître d’exploration du domaine :
      Browstat + VIEW+ transport + nom netbios du domaine + le maître d’exploration du domaine   (le résultat du point 3)

C:\Program Files\Resource Kit>browstat view \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728} paris \\tata

6.- Et enfin, annoncer une machine sur le réseau :
      Browstat + announce + transport + nom netbios du domaine

C:\Program Files\Resource Kit>browstat announce Device\NetBT_Tcpip_{76DE5B7D-4948-45C2-AA67-E5335D2BD728} paris


Article N° 213 du 09.01.2004 12:46:02 par Alain Gremaud -- Permalink : http://windows.epfl.ch/?article=213